Output f3ca5b623286283ced86006a541ade61dece84e5ca66c32beab5e86e272dd160:0

value
11715075
script pubkey
OP_0 OP_PUSHBYTES_20 e24dbd17266430d0bd4258fdced493ee01c78a8e
address
bc1qufxm69exvscdp02ztr7ua4ynacqu0z5whc5zsn
transaction
f3ca5b623286283ced86006a541ade61dece84e5ca66c32beab5e86e272dd160
confirmations
173274
spent
true